Bryson Stott And Phillies Play Cardinals On Aug. 21
Bryson Stott and the Philadelphia Phillies will take on the St. Louis Cardinals at Citizens Bank Park, on Friday, Aug. 21 at 6:40 p.m. ET. Stott has +710 odds to hit a home run as of Friday afternoon.
What It Means
Stott is hitting for a .264 BA, .341 OBP and .414 SLG with a 16.4% strikeout rate and a 10.2% walk rate. His OPS is .755 and he has scored 56 runs. In 481 plate appearances, he has hit nine home runs and driven in 59 runs. Stott has recorded 23 steals on 23 attempts. In his last game he had a hitless performance (0 for 4) against the Marlins.
Hunter Dobbins gets the start for the Cardinals, his eighth of the season. He is 3-3 with a 3.42 ERA and 49 strikeouts in 50 2/3 innings pitched.
